Dubai Police Arrest 116 Beggars in First Half of Ramadan

Dubai: «Gulf»

Major General Jamal Salem Al-Jallaf, Director of the General Department of Investigations and Criminal Investigations in Dubai Police, confirmed that the “Fight Begging” campaign managed, during the first half of the blessed month of Ramadan, to arrest 116 beggars, including 59 males and 57 females, and seized sums of money they collected from them. By claiming the need, to win over members of society.

Major General Al-Jallaf stressed that beggars take advantage of the holy month of Ramadan and religious feelings in order to collect money illegally, so they deceive people and take advantage of the feelings of those who fast in the holy month, explaining that one of the cases that the Dubai Police arrested belonged to two brothers married to two sisters, and one of them had a child.

He added that the policemen caught the two brothers and their wives begging passers-by near a mosque, by performing deceitful gestures indicating that the couple suffers from a disability, contrary to the truth.

Major General Al-Jallaf emphasized the importance of not responding to the beggars of beggars, or dealing with them with feelings of pity and sympathy for their appearance, and helping the police agencies by immediately reporting any beggar who is spotted anywhere on the call center (901) or the Police Eye platform through smart applications of Dubai Police, and service ( E-Crime) to report cybercrime.

Major General Jamal Al-Jallaf explained that there are official bodies, charitable organizations and associations that anyone can turn to to request financial assistance, pointing out that there are people who justify the reason for their begging by their need for money, and this matter is illegal and punishable by the Federal Law according to Article No. 9 of 2018 regarding combating beggary and referring them. to eliminate.

In turn, Colonel Ali Salem, Director of the Infiltrators Department at the General Department of Criminal Investigations and Investigations, confirmed that the campaign to combat begging launched by the Dubai Police under the slogan “Begging is a Misconception of Compassion”, since the beginning of the holy month of Ramadan, continues its tasks by intensifying patrols in the expected places. beggars in it.

He stressed that the phenomenon of begging threatens the security of society and the life and property of its members, harms the image of the state, and distorts its civilized appearance.
